Midea Air Conditioner Features

Midea offers a range of air conditioners with various features to cater to the diverse needs of consumers. One prominent feature includes the Inverter Technology that ensures energy efficiency and consistent comfort. Additionally, Midea’s air conditioners come with a smart control system, allowing users to control the device remotely using smartphones or voice command through devices like Google Home and Amazon Alexa.

The air conditioners also offer a Dual Filtration System, which combines an Active Carbon filter and a Silver Ion filter to ensure the release of fresh and purified air.

Another essential feature present in Midea’s air conditioners is the Turbo Mode, designed to reach the desired temperature quickly. When activated, the air conditioner operates at high speed, reducing room temperature in a short amount of time.

To maintain the desired temperature, Midea air conditioners come equipped with the Sleep Mode feature. When enabled, the system adjusts the room temperature and fan speed automatically, resulting in a comfortable sleeping environment.

Furthermore, the air conditioners showcase an Energy-saving Mode, where the system continually adjusts the cooling operation to minimise power consumption.

Ease of installation and service is another key feature of Midea air conditioners. The Self-diagnosis Function detects issues and errors in the system, streamlining troubleshooting and maintenance procedures.

Efficiency and Energy Ratings

Midea air conditioners are designed with a focus on efficiency and energy savings. As a global leader in air conditioning technology, the company strives to achieve high energy performance while ensuring comfort and reliability for consumers.

One key feature of Midea air conditioners is the inverter technology. This advanced system enables the unit to adjust its cooling or heating capacity according to the fluctuating temperature outside and the set temperature indoors. This minimises energy consumption, prolonging the life of the air conditioner components and providing users with consistent comfort.

Midea air conditioners are also equipped with smart energy-saving features that further enhance their performance and optimise their usage. These include:

  • Sleep Mode: Automatically adjusts the temperature and fan speed for optimal sleeping conditions at night.
  • 24 Hour Timer Function: Allows users to program the air conditioner to turn on and off at specific times, promoting better energy management.
  • ECO Mode: Modifies the operation of the air conditioner to reduce energy consumption while maintaining a comfortable environment.

Different Models of Midea Air Conditioners

Midea offers a wide range of air conditioner models, catering to the diverse needs and preferences of customers. Some popular options include:

  • Window Air Conditioners: These compact units are ideal for cooling small spaces and are easy to install. Midea’s window air conditioners come in various capacities, efficiently catering to different room sizes.
  • Split System Air Conditioners: Midea’s split system air conditioners are known for their advanced technology and energy efficiency. They consist of an indoor and outdoor unit, providing powerful cooling and heating options.
  • Portable Air Conditioners: These are versatile air conditioning solutions that can be easily moved from one room to another. Midea’s portable air conditioners offer convenience, flexibility, and efficient cooling performance.
  • Ducted Air Conditioners: Midea’s ducted air conditioning systems provide a comprehensive solution for cooling and heating multiple rooms. They are perfect for larger homes, offering quiet and energy-efficient operation.

Midea’s air conditioners come with innovative features that cater to various needs, including:

  • Inverter Technology: Midea’s inverter air conditioners are energy-efficient and offer steady cooling and heating performance. They adjust the compressor’s speed in response to the cooling demand, ensuring optimal performance and reduced energy consumption.
  • Smart Control: Many Midea models are equipped with Wi-Fi connectivity that facilitates effortless control via smartphones or voice control using digital assistants such as Google Home or Amazon Alexa. This enables users to adjust settings, program schedules, and perform actions like switching the unit on or off remotely.
  • Air Filtration: Midea’s air conditioners come with advanced air filtration systems that can remove airborne pollutants, such as dust and allergens, while neutralising odours. This ensures a clean and healthy indoor environment.
  • Energy Efficiency: Midea air conditioners boast impressive energy efficiency ratings, reducing electricity consumption and lowering utility bills. Some models are also compatible with solar power systems, further reducing their environmental impact.

To clean the filter on a Midea air conditioner, follow these steps:

  1. Turn off the unit and unplug it from the power source.
  2. Open the front panel of the indoor unit.
  3. Gently remove the filter by pulling it towards you.
  4. Use a vacuum cleaner or soft brush to clean the dust off the filter.
  5. Rinse the filter under running water and leave it to air dry.
  6. Reinsert the filter into the indoor unit and close the front panel.
  7. Plug in the unit and switch it on.

To set up the WiFi on your Midea air conditioner, follow these steps:

  1. Download the MideaAir app from the App Store or Google Play.
  2. Create an account or log in to the app.
  3. Tap on the "+" icon to add a new device.
  4. Power on the air conditioner and ensure it is in standby mode.
  5. Press and hold the WiFi button on the air conditioner until the WiFi LED blinks rapidly.
  6. Return to the app and follow the on-screen instructions to complete the setup.

Operating a Midea air conditioner with the remote involves the following key functions:

  1. Power Button: Turns the unit on or off.
  2. Mode Button: Selects the operating mode (cool, heat, dry, or fan).
  3. Temperature Buttons: Adjusts the set temperature.
  4. Fan Speed Button: Changes the fan speed (low, medium, high, or auto).
  5. Swing Button: Controls the air swing direction.

For a detailed guide, refer to the product manual that comes with the air conditioner.

To control your Midea air conditioner using the app, follow these steps:

  1. Ensure your air conditioner is connected to WiFi (refer to the previous section for setup).
  2. Open the MideaAir app on your smartphone or tablet.
  3. Sign in to your account and select your device from the list.
  4. Use the app to adjust the operating mode, temperature, fan speed, and other settings as needed.
